Ruby Hotels expands to Athens with first property in 2027

  • k.fytaki1
  • 27 June 2025
🏨 Ruby Hotels and Primetown Development are partnering on a €20m development near Omonia Square, Athens. The project spans 3,200 m² and features a 24/7 bar, breakfast area, rooftop with panoramic views, and pool terrace. This new addition aligns with IHG's strategy, following their acquisition of Ruby in 2025, expanding their presence with ten Greek properties. Ruby's Southern Europe expansion continues with new projects in Italy, including the upcoming Rome hotel opening in spring 2025.

[UPDATE] IHG opens first Garner hotel in Scotland

  • m.welsch1
  • 26 June 2025
🏨 Garner Hotels debuts in Scotland with the opening of Garner Hotel Edinburgh Haymarket, a 195-room property in Edinburgh’s West End, near key landmarks like Haymarket Station and Edinburgh Castle. Launching during Edinburgh's festival season, it offers affordable, comfortable accommodation. For a limited time, £1 per guest stay is donated to Action Against Hunger. Garner Hotels, launched in 2023, now has 23 properties open and 94 in development.

Hilton opens The Marcus in Portrush, expanding Tapestry Collection in Northern Ireland

  • k.fytaki1
  • 26 June 2025
🏨 The Marcus Portrush, a newly renovated 80-room hotel in Northern Ireland, opened after an £11 million transformation of a Victorian building. Opened ahead of the 153rd Open Championship at Royal Portrush, it includes an Asian fusion restaurant and Heritage Cocktail Bar. The hotel is expected to generate £1.1 million annually for the local economy and create over 40 jobs. It's part of Hilton's Tapestry Collection, which is expanding in Europe.

The Ancient Shepherds by Mark Poynton: an all new dining experience in an established location

  • Sophie Weir
  • 26 June 2025
🍴 On 16 July 2025, Mark Poynton, alongside Gareth and Emma John, will launch The Ancient Shepherds in Fen Ditton, near Cambridge. The restaurant, previously MJP @ The Shepherds, will offer a tasting-only menu with 3, 5, or 7 courses. Mark, who recently earned a Michelin star for Caistor Hall, aims for minimal waste and employee satisfaction with a four-day work week. The 34-seat venue includes a refurbished pub and five rooms for overnight stays.

Scandic expands in Tromsø with new hotel : The Dock 69°39

  • k.fytaki1
  • 25 June 2025
🏨 The new 12-story hotel in Vervet district covers 17,300 m², featuring sustainable elements like recycled fishing net carpets, a heated rooftop running track, and Nordic Swan Ecolabel certification. The Dock 69°39 by Scandic includes a rooftop bar, wellness area with sauna, and 10th-floor restaurant. Scandic expands in Scandinavia with a 236-room hotel in Uppsala, an alpine hotel in Sälen for 2027/2028, and Scandic Go Sankt Eriksgatan 20 in Stockholm with 234 rooms.

The Social Hub ramps up investments in local communities, unveiling ‘transformative’ public parks in Rome and Florence  

  • Sophie Weir
  • 25 June 2025
🌳 The Social Hub opens two major parks in Florence and Rome, designed by Antonio Perazzi, with a €260 million investment. Florence features a 7,000 m² rooftop garden with 4,000 plants and a 50m pool. Rome's 10,000 m² park includes art installations and over 300 trees. The Florence rooftop opened in March 2025 and Rome's park in April. The projects enhance urban biodiversity and hospitality standards. Over 1,200 community events are planned annually.

Líbere Hospitality Group expands in Italy with new property in Rome

  • k.fytaki1
  • 24 June 2025
🏗️ Líbere will open 18 new apartments near Rome's Termini station by September 2025. The project, Líbere's third in Italy, aims to meet the demand for short- and medium-term rentals in tourist-heavy Rome. Italy's tourism contributes 10.8% to its GDP, with the market expected to grow. Meanwhile, Líbere will maintain the historical façade, damaged in World War II, in line with urban and heritage regulations.

The Royal Bell to reopen as boutique hotel and club

  • Claudia Schergna
  • 24 June 2025
🏨 UK, Autumn 2025, Bromley: The Royal Bell, a Grade II-listed building dating back to 1666, reopens after a multi-year restoration led by The BELLE Collective. The five-floor venue features 14 boutique rooms, a bar and grill, pizzeria, and members-only amenities like coworking lounges and a fitness studio. Memberships start at £110/month. The restoration aims to blend heritage with modern hospitality, spearheaded by investors Mark Goldberg, Jon Yantin, and Nick Gold.
